At first glance, we see that the PSU is
semi-modular with mostly the GPU and
SATA cables being able to be switched in
and out. Seeing as this is a semi-modular
PSU, it also allows users to keep the
insides of their chassis nice and neat as
they can remove cables that they aren’t
using. The colour highlights on the ports
make it beginner friendly for those who
are just entering the DIY PC scene. The
PSU also sports a cool blue neon light
that gives the PSU a futuristic look and
while definitely be something gamers
and modders will like as it adds that extra
flash to their system.
Under the hood of the beast, is a 1200
watts powerhouse which has no qualms
powering up even the most power
hungry components. It has the standard
80 Plus Gold rating found on most highend consumer PSUs nowadays. It also
has an in-built current management to
protect your CPU from fluctuating power
transfer to prevent short circuits and
interruption to your work or games.
